Mesothelioma lawsuits can result in significant settlements for asbestos victims and their families. Settlements can be used to pay for medical expenses, loss of income funeral expenses and more. These settlements are also intended to compensate victims for their pain and suffering.

Mesothelioma is a very common cancer that is found in those who have been exposed to asbestos at work. They might have worked in mines, factories or power plants. Others were exposed to asbestos while serving in the military. In these instances, the victims and their families can file a claim at the Department of Veterans Affairs.

Pleural mesothelioma is a lung cancer and is the most common mesothelioma form. This type of mesothelioma may be caused by exposure to asbestos in structures constructed before 1975, including homes, schools, and office buildings. These types of buildings often included asbestos insulation that was used to create pipes and other equipment. Asbestos can release microscopic fibres into the air which can contaminate your home or business.

Those diagnosed with mesothelioma may be eligible for VA benefits or to file a lawsuit against asbestos. Mesothelioma lawyers can help patients with these claims and also assist with mesothelioma settlements from asbestos trust funds or insurance companies.

Contingency Fees

Mesothelioma is a devastating illness that can result in costly treatments for cancer and loss of wages. A mesothelioma lawyer should ensure that victims and their families receive compensation to pay for these costs. The best mesothelioma lawyers operate on a contingent fee. This means that they only get paid when they win the case. This arrangement is based on the client's needs and will help them obtain the maximum amount of mesothelioma compensation possible.

In a mesothelioma suit, an experienced lawyer will work with the victim to collect evidence, such as medical records and asbestos exposure history and records of employers. They will also speak with witnesses, take depositions and create a settlement proposal. They will also prepare for trial should it be necessary. Mesothelioma attorneys have access to databases that allow them to monitor mesothelioma asbestos exposure as well as identify responsible parties. They can also seek expert witnesses who will be able to testify in the courtroom.

A mesothelioma lawyer can ensure that your lawsuit is filed conformity with the laws of the state's statutes of limitations. This deadline begins on the date the claimant was diagnosed for personal injury cases or when the victim died for the wrongful death claim. They will also ensure that the correct defendants are named and that all documents are filed.

Mesothelioma lawyers may handle multi-defendant litigation, and assist in the preparation of discovery requests, declarations in writing concerning asbestos exposure, as well as filing summary motions for judgment. They can also assist clients in managing bankruptcy trusts and disputing claims.
